Te Wahi Pinot Noir 2015
Cloudy Bay

Floral overtones of new oak play on the nose. The palate is a picture of restrained sumptuousness: although the texture is rich, the body remains slender. Freshness, white pepper spice and gentle, dark cherry fruit characters. Score: 92 Decanter, Decanter.com Maturity: 2020-2028 07 October 2018 |

A 50-50 blend of fruit from Northburn and Bannockburn (Cloudy Bay leases a portion of the Calvert Vineyard), the 2015 Te Wahi Pinot Noir is a full-bodied, plummy wine. It shows some pretty florals on the nose, but the palate is chocolaty and rich, offering hints of cola and dark-skinned plums. It's powerful and plush, with a velvety texture and lingering finish, almost verging on Californian (Russian River Valley?) in style. Score: 91 Joe Czerwinski, Wine Advocate, RobertParker.com Maturity: 2018-2025 28 February 2018 |

This shows plenty of fruit richness with darker cherries, toasted spices and earthy aromas, as well as some fresh violet-like florals, too. The palate is succulent, smoothly layered and has attractive tannins that build in layers to a smooth, pastry-like finish. Ready now. Score: 93 James Suckling, JamesSuckling.com Maturity: 2017+ 28 March 2017 |
